
在Excel中隐藏批注的方法包括:在批注选项中选择"隐藏批注"、使用VBA代码隐藏批注、将批注的文字删除。这些方法可以帮助你在工作表中保持整洁、避免干扰。
一、在批注选项中选择“隐藏批注”
在Excel中,批注默认是以小红点的形式显示在单元格的右上角,当鼠标悬停在这些单元格上时,批注内容会自动弹出。如果你希望所有批注都不显示,可以通过以下步骤进行设置:
-
步骤一:打开Excel文件
打开你需要操作的Excel工作表。
-
步骤二:进入选项菜单
点击“文件”菜单,然后选择“选项”。
-
步骤三:进入高级设置
在弹出的Excel选项对话框中,选择左侧的“高级”选项卡。
-
步骤四:调整批注显示设置
向下滚动,找到“显示”部分。在这里,你会看到一个“批注和指示器”选项,将其设置为“无”。
通过这一简单设置,Excel将不再显示所有批注及其指示器。
二、使用VBA代码隐藏批注
如果你需要更高效、更灵活的方法来隐藏批注,可以使用VBA代码。这种方法适用于需要对大量批注进行批量操作的场景。
-
步骤一:打开VBA编辑器
按下“Alt + F11”打开VBA编辑器。
-
步骤二:插入模块
在VBA编辑器中,点击“插入”菜单,然后选择“模块”。
-
步骤三:输入代码
在模块中输入以下代码:
Sub HideComments()Dim ws As Worksheet
Dim cmt As Comment
For Each ws In ThisWorkbook.Worksheets
For Each cmt In ws.Comments
cmt.Visible = False
Next cmt
Next ws
End Sub
-
步骤四:运行代码
按下“F5”键或点击“运行”按钮执行代码。所有工作表中的批注将被隐藏。
三、将批注的文字删除
如果你希望彻底清除批注内容,可以直接删除批注的文字。这种方法适用于不再需要批注内容的场景。
-
步骤一:选择包含批注的单元格
点击带有批注的小红点的单元格。
-
步骤二:右键菜单
右键点击该单元格,然后选择“编辑批注”。
-
步骤三:删除文字
删除批注框中的所有文字,然后按下“Enter”键。
通过上述方法,你可以有效地管理Excel中的批注显示,确保工作表的整洁和易读性。接下来将详细介绍这些方法的具体操作和注意事项。
一、在批注选项中选择“隐藏批注”
1、打开Excel文件
首先,确保你已经安装并启动了Microsoft Excel。打开你需要操作的Excel工作表。这个工作表可以是任何版本的Excel文件,如.xlsx、.xls等。
2、进入选项菜单
在Excel主界面中,点击左上角的“文件”菜单。这将打开一个下拉菜单,其中包含许多选项。向下滚动并找到“选项”,然后点击它。这将打开一个新的对话框,名为“Excel选项”。
3、进入高级设置
在“Excel选项”对话框中,有多个选项卡。点击左侧的“高级”选项卡。在这个选项卡中,你会看到一个非常长的设置列表。这些设置涵盖了Excel的许多高级功能。
4、调整批注显示设置
向下滚动,直到找到“显示”部分。在这里,你会看到一个名为“批注和指示器”的选项。该选项有三个设置:
- 显示批注和指示器:这是默认设置,会在单元格右上角显示红色三角形,并在鼠标悬停时显示批注内容。
- 不显示批注,只显示指示器:这将隐藏批注内容,但仍会显示红色三角形。
- 不显示批注和指示器:这将隐藏所有批注和指示器。
选择“无”,然后点击“确定”按钮。此时,所有批注及其指示器将从工作表中消失。
注意事项
虽然这种方法可以有效地隐藏所有批注,但请注意,批注本身并没有被删除。如果你或其他用户再次更改这些设置,批注将再次显示。因此,这种方法适用于临时隐藏批注的场景。
二、使用VBA代码隐藏批注
VBA(Visual Basic for Applications)是一种专为Microsoft Office应用程序设计的编程语言。使用VBA代码可以实现许多高级操作,包括批量隐藏批注。
1、打开VBA编辑器
在Excel主界面中,按下“Alt + F11”组合键。这将打开VBA编辑器,一个用于编写和运行VBA代码的独立窗口。
2、插入模块
在VBA编辑器中,点击“插入”菜单,然后选择“模块”。这将在项目资源管理器中创建一个新的模块,通常命名为“Module1”。你将在这个模块中编写代码。
3、输入代码
在模块编辑器中,输入以下代码:
Sub HideComments()
Dim ws As Worksheet
Dim cmt As Comment
For Each ws In ThisWorkbook.Worksheets
For Each cmt In ws.Comments
cmt.Visible = False
Next cmt
Next ws
End Sub
这段代码定义了一个名为“HideComments”的子程序。程序首先声明两个变量:ws(工作表)和cmt(批注)。然后,它遍历当前工作簿中的每个工作表,并遍历每个工作表中的每个批注,将其可见性设置为False。
4、运行代码
在VBA编辑器中,按下“F5”键或点击工具栏上的“运行”按钮。程序将开始执行,所有工作表中的批注将被隐藏。
注意事项
使用VBA代码隐藏批注具有以下优点:
- 批量操作:可以一次性隐藏多个工作表中的所有批注。
- 灵活性:可以根据需要修改代码,实现更复杂的操作。
然而,使用VBA代码也有一些注意事项:
- 安全性:确保你信任的代码来源,因为VBA代码可以执行许多敏感操作。
- 恢复:如果需要恢复批注显示,可以使用相似的VBA代码,将
cmt.Visible设置为True。
三、将批注的文字删除
如果你决定彻底清除批注内容,可以直接删除批注的文字。这种方法适用于不再需要批注内容的场景。
1、选择包含批注的单元格
在Excel工作表中,找到带有批注的小红点的单元格。点击该单元格以选中它。
2、右键菜单
右键点击该单元格,这将打开一个上下文菜单。在菜单中选择“编辑批注”。此时,批注框将显示在单元格旁边,你可以编辑其中的内容。
3、删除文字
在批注框中,选中所有文字,然后按下“Delete”键或“Backspace”键删除它们。完成后,按下“Enter”键或点击批注框外的任意位置以确认更改。
注意事项
这种方法非常简单直接,但有以下几点需要注意:
- 不可恢复:一旦批注内容被删除,将无法恢复,除非你有备份。
- 单独操作:每个批注都需要单独删除,适用于批注数量较少的情况。
通过上述方法,你可以有效地管理Excel中的批注显示,确保工作表的整洁和易读性。无论是通过调整显示设置、使用VBA代码,还是直接删除批注内容,每种方法都有其独特的优势和适用场景。根据你的具体需求,选择最适合的方法,确保工作表的高效和有序。
相关问答FAQs:
1. 如何在Excel中将批注设置为隐藏或不显示?
- 在Excel中,选择包含批注的单元格。
- 单击“审阅”选项卡上的“显示批注”按钮。
- 批注将被隐藏,不再显示在单元格旁边。
2. 如何在Excel中取消隐藏批注并重新显示出来?
- 在Excel中,选择包含隐藏批注的单元格。
- 单击“审阅”选项卡上的“显示批注”按钮。
- 批注将重新显示在单元格旁边。
3. 是否可以在Excel中设置某些批注隐藏,而其他批注仍然显示?
- 是的,您可以选择性地隐藏或显示Excel中的批注。
- 选择包含批注的单元格。
- 单击鼠标右键,选择“批注”选项。
- 在弹出的菜单中,选择“隐藏批注”或“显示批注”来控制批注的可见性。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4469748